Ag Leadership & Communications

Ag Leadership (S1): This course will help students develop leadership skills with a focus on opportunities within the agriculture industry. Topics may include but are not limited to human relationships and effective communication, decision making and problem-solving, leadership qualities and styles, and ensuring effective completion of group activities. Self-concepts will be developed through situational leadership, principles of people management, goal setting, and belief systems.

Ag Communications (S2): This course introduces the broad field of agricultural communications and allows for the development of knowledge and skill in specific areas related to communications theory and practice. Content includes agricultural communications, news and writing in ag, photography, layout and design, and ethics in agriculture communications. Students will also learn to focus on the personal skills necessary for success in entrepreneurial ventures within the agricultural industry. Topics include setting goals, assessing and solving problems, evaluating financial progress and success, and business planning. Content will also include marketing and broadcast journalism in agriculture.
